    3 out of 5 stars Rolicking Action; So-so Plot & Characters.......2005-06-05

    Those who are simply looking for an action adventure set in Games Workshop's 40K universe - or those who enjoyed the first two Soul Drinkers novels - will like this book as well. All the elements of 40K, from elite Space Marines to the mass troops and armor of the Imperial Guard, are there. All the characters from the first two novels - Sarpedon and the all the rest of the Soul Drinkers - are there.

    Unfortunately, the plot devices and many of the supporting cast are clumsy and/or forced so M. Counter can make his points. The Crimson Fists are mindless automatons, complete slaves to tradition and the Codex, single-mindedly pursuing the Soul Drinkers to the exclusion of all else ... until it's convenient to the plot for them not to do so. They serve as the "enslaved" counterpoint to the "freedom" that the Soul Drinkers have achieved. The plot device used to get the Soul Drinkers into the story at the outset is conveniently ignored when it's time for them to leave.

    In short, entertaining to fans who don't look too closely at the writer's craft.

                Book Description

                This volume is one of several that examine the National Gallery of Art's distinguished collection of decorative arts. The group treated here is composed primarily of works acquired from the Widener Collection, and amplified by holdings acquired from the Kress family. Included are more than
                eighty Medieval, Renaissance, and historicizing objects in a wide variety of media, encompassing metalwork, stained glass, enamels, ceramics, and jewels. Among the highlights are a Limoges reliquary chasse, a Mosan lion aquamanile, thirty-eight pieces in a cohesive group of Italian maiolica, three
                of the very rare French pottery objects known as "Saint-Porchaire," and, the centerpiece of the collection, the Suger chalice, an ancient sardonyx cup to which the Abbot Suger added a bejewelled golden setting in the twelfth century.

                Like other volumes in the Systematic Catalogue of the National Gallery of Art Collections, Western Decorative Arts includes a thoroughly researched entry for each object, together with an artist biography, up-to-date bibliography, and a technical analysis.

                  Book Description

                  The National Gallery's collection of eighteenth-century American paintings includes some of its greatest treasures and most beloved national icons. John Singleton Copley's Watson and the Shark, Gilbert Stuart's The Skater (Portrait of William Granti) and George Washington (Vaughan portrait)--as well as his portraits of the first five presidents of the United States, the so-called Gibbs-Coolidge portraits--and Edward Savage's Washington Family. Ellen G. Miles, curator of painting and sculpture at the National Portrait Gallery, Smithsonian Institution, presents new research culled from letters, wills, and other previously unpublished documents that offer a fresh perspective on the artists and sitters, as well as new insight into the paintings. (This publication is made possible by a grant from the Henry Luce Foundation).

                  Book Description

                  From the hardships of a long and arduous war with Spain, the seventeenth-century Dutch seem to have drawn strength and expressed pride in their unique social and cultural heritage, especially in their art. Arthur K. Wheelock Jr., the Gallery's curator of northern Baroque painting, has carefully studied the Gallery's collection by masters of the Golden Age of Dutch art--notably Cuyp, De Hooch, Rembrandt, Ruisdael, and Vermeer. The twenty-three paintings by Rembrandt and his school are elucidated by an essay on the question of attribution, while an appendix of artists' signatures amplifies and supports the author's wide-ranging discussions of this remarkably cohesive collection.

                    Book Description

                    Some of the most important Italian baroque paintings in America are included here: major works by Anton Maria Vassallo, Bernardo Strozzi, Donato Creti, Sebastiano Ricci, and Giambattista Tiepolo; a number of view paintings by the popular eighteenth-century Venetian artists Canaletto, Bellotto, and Guardi; and the only landscape by Annibale Carracci in the United States. Among the sixty-nine works presented are Orazio Gentileschi's Lute Player, considered his masterpiece; Jusepe de Ribera's Martyrdom of Saint Bartholomew; and one of Bernardo Bellotto's largest and best paintings, The Fortress of Knigstein.

                      Book Description

                      In this second of two volumes devoted to the Gallery's holdings of nineteenth-century American paintings, more than 100 works are catalogued. Distinguished in part by the concentration of works by three prominent artists, Thomas Sully, John Singer Sargent, and James McNeill Whistler, the collection also includes John Quidor's The Return of Rip van Winkle, Albert Pinkham Ryder's Siegfried and the Rhine Maidens, John Henry Twachtman's Winter Harmony, and Rembrandt Peale's best-known work, Rubens Peale with a Geranium. Many of these paintings are reproduced in full color for the first time.

                        Book Description

                        This volume is devoted to the paintings in the National Gallery of Art that were produced by British artists, or by foreign artists who spent the greater part of their working lives in Britain, from the sixteenth through the nineteenth centuries. Composed mainly of paintings acquired by such
                        prominent nineteenth-century industrialists as Andrew Mellon and P.A.B. Widener, the core of this important collection is a series of portraits by such masters as Gainsborough, Lawrence, Raeburn, and Romney, who represent the "golden age" of British painting. Brilliant landscapes by Constable,
                        Turner, and Wilson, among others, attest to another genre in which British artists have long excelled. Arranged alphabetically by artist, full catalogue entries articulate the history, style, content, and context of each work, with technical notes offering insight into the artists' working methods.
                        The volume also contains introductory biographies of each artist, as well as an up-to-date bibliography for each painting.

                          Book Description

                          This catalogue contains entries on fifteenth- and sixteenth- (and one seventeenth-) century German (and Austrian) paintings in the National Gallery of Art, Washington DC, both German and Austrian. Entries are arranged alphabetically by artist and there is a short biography and bibliography for each artist. Individual entries follow the model established by earlier systematic catalogues and full scholarly and technical information is provided for each painting. Questions of attribution, iconography, and social and religious function and context are discussed and, where relevant, comparative examples, reconstructions of altarpieces, x-radiography and infra-red reflectogram assemblies are included. The catalogue also contains the results of dendrochronological examinations of the paintings.
